MS Indian language input tool

Staff Reporter

HYDERABAD: Microsoft India Development Centre (MSIDC) unveiled ‘Indic Language Input Tool’ here on Wednesday for better and broader adoption of computing technologies in Indian languages. The free-form transliteration software tool will be made available soon for users as a free download in beta version.

Unveiling the new software, managing director of MSIDC Srini Koppolu stated that the tool would initially support six Indian languages — Hindi, Telugu, Tamil, Kannada, Bengali and Malayalam — and would be extended to eight more languages later.
